Transaction de66630a866e379ed49eaf6ebefe2d6894f0bce064cc8f87143ced59227247a8
1 Input
1 Output
-
de66630a866e379ed49eaf6ebefe2d6894f0bce064cc8f87143ced59227247a8:0
- value
- 673884
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 071dcf61cdd8f3fa88dfc1ad2220024ddf9b89b8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1edSasGTS4CR9cCqCkwSj65oCJSZwqUf9